Job Summary:
The EHR Implementation Training Specialist reports to the Manager of Implementations and is a remote position. This position may require significant travel (averaging 2 – 3 days per week during a two-week period).
The primary role of the EHR Implementation Training Specialist, is to provide education and support to clinical operations, with all aspects of implementation of our Healogics databases and applications. This individual will interact directly with program directors, providers, clinicians and other staff members and serve as the main point of contact for onsite and post go live support. The individual in this role will also assist in the execution phase of various projects forthcoming as well as assist existing customers with multiple levels of database and application support.

Essential Functions/Responsibilities:  
  • Acknowledges, appropriately greets and assists every customer in a courteous, efficient and timely manner
  • Conducts training to ensure proficiency of staff, including center physicians
  • Provides Go Live and ongoing support during and after implementation
  • Travels to and from field locations
  • Effectively collects and synthesizes data and information from multiple sources
  • Troubleshoots any routine problems that staff cannot fix on their own, such as a problems with the printer or a computer
  • Becomes familiar with available help resources; stays updated on technology changes or problems
  • Performs other duties as required

Required Education, Experience and Credentials:
  • High school diploma or equivalent required with at least five (5) years of relevant experience
  • Bachelor’s degree preferred with at least two (2) years of relevant experience
  • Equivalent combination of education and experience will be considered

Required Knowledge, Skills and Abilities:
  • Experience with healthcare software preferred
  • Proficient computer skills including Microsoft Word and Excel (required)
  • Ability to build or edit training materials
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ills
  • Strong training and presentation skills with the ability to develop training / educational material and deliver in a classroom setting or a one-on-one environment
  • Ability to examine and resolve complex issues
  • Strong organizational and time management skills
  • Ability to work effectively as a team
